Birmingham 2022: Team Nigeria’s Yusuf Wins Bronze Medal In Weightlifting

Islamiyat Adebukola Yusuf has won Team Nigeria’s fourth medal at the 2022 Commonwealth Games in Birmingham.

Yusuf clinched bronze medal in the women’s weightlifting 64kg category after a combined lift of 212kg.

The 19-year-old lifted 93kg in the Snatch and Clean & Jerk: 113kg, 116kg, 119kg with total of 212kg.

Adijat Olarinoye won Nigeria’s first gold medal in weightlifting and at the games on Saturday.

Olarinoye produced a stunning lift in the women’s 55kg category.

On Sunday, Folashade Rafiat Lawal won gold medal in the 59kg category setting a Commonwealth Games record in the process.

Edidiong Umoafia also picked bronze medal in the weightlifting event on Sunday.
